- Casino Barriere de Biarritz - The tour will commence at this location.
- Place Georges Clemenceau - Here, the group will delve into the intriguing history and curiosities of this summer retreat favored by French and Russian nobility.
- Place Bellevue - This charming square, encircled by renowned cafés like Café de Paris, offers a chance to admire the Hôtel du Palais, a testament to Eugénie de Montijo and Napoleon III, with views of the surfing beach and the historic casino.
- Rocher du Basta - A perfect spot for photography, offering views of the Biarritz lighthouse.
- Port des Pecheurs - The group will explore Biarritz’s history of whaling, dating back to its days as a quaint fishing village amidst a coastline of privateers.
- Rocher de la Vierge - At Rocher de la Vierge, participants will enjoy breathtaking views of the Spanish coast, taking in the stunning scenery that extends across the horizon.
- Eglise Sainte-Eugenie - The group will view Église Sainte-Eugénie from the outside. Along the way, there will be an opportunity to admire some of Biarritz’s remarkable neo-medieval villas, which are over 150 years old.
- Mercado Les Halles - At this stop, the group will explore the diverse array of local products that make this region special. From the renowned Bayonne ham, celebrated for its delicate flavor, to the vibrant Espelette pepper, a cornerstone of Basque cuisine. The discussion will also cover the exceptional cheeses produced in the area, the fresh oysters sourced from nearby waters, and many other regional delicacies that highlight the rich culinary traditions of this land.

Explore the charm of southwest France with a walking tour of Biarritz, the crown jewel of Aquitaine. Start your journey at the grand Casino and discover how Biarritz transformed from a humble whaling village into a luxurious getaway favored by royalty and fashion icons like Coco Chanel, who established one of her early boutiques here.
Take in the exterior of the Hôtel du Palais, delve into the history at the Church of Saint Eugenia, and visit the Museum of the Sea to appreciate the city’s strong ties to the Atlantic Ocean. The tour concludes at the Rocher de la Vierge, a natural vantage point offering breathtaking views of the Basque French coast.
